Video Controls |
Use the video controls to control playback, seek within the presentation, view full-screen video,
and adjust the video playback speed. When you are viewing a live presentation, you cannot pause,
stop, or seek within the presentation. Also, you cannot adjust the video playback speed. Note: If the video for the presentation does not appear, verify the presentation is not an
audio-only presentation and that you have the current version of Windows Media Player installed. If you do
not have the current version, go to the Windows Media download site. Play, pause, and stop
Note: If you stopped the presentation, playback will start at the beginning of the presentation when you click Play. Using the video seek bar
Move backward or forward in the presentation by moving the video seek bar left or right, respectively. Adjust video playback speed
Increase or decrease the speed at which an on-demand presentation is played back by moving the Speed tab up towards fast or down towards slow, respectively. Adjust volume
View full-screen video
Click Full Screen to expand a presentation's video so that is fills the entire screen. Press Esc to exit full-screen mode. |
